Tainted you have a very good point, but I seem to think its a matter of where the car is marketed, in the US the Infiniti G-35 coupe and 4door are exactly mechanically identical to the new 350 Z. I think the case in Japan is that Nissan is trying to push the car with a well-known name hence calling it a Skyline. Plus to my knowledge the Infiniti label is not used in Japan there all strictly Nissans.
